As a Senior Electrical PCB Layout Designer at Nokia, you will play a critical role in transforming schematic designs and mechanical constraints into high-quality, manufacturable printed circuit boards. Collaborating closely with hardware design engineers, you'll utilize design for manufacturing (DFM) guidelines from our PCB suppliers to ensure functionality and reliability. Your contributions will be vital in advancing unique designs that push the boundaries of technology, paving the way for next-generation innovations. Responsibilities
  • Execute high-speed, high-density PCB layouts for cutting-edge optical sub-assemblies, pushing the boundaries of design innovation.
  • Create and manage comprehensive layout and build files, covering PCB design, ceramic and organic substrate designs, and intricate multi-layer packaging.
  • Collaborate closely with electrical and mechanical design teams to establish effective floor planning and PCB constraints, ensuring seamless integration.
  • Work alongside hardware engineers, signal integrity specialists, and mechanical designers to optimize PCB layouts for performance and manufacturability.
  • Develop and maintain schematic symbols and component footprints, streamlining design workflows for maximum efficiency.
  • Complete schematic capture in partnership with the electrical design team, bringing cohesive designs to fruition.
  • Contribute to next-generation PCB design technologies, enhancing your skills while shaping the future of the industry.
  • Tap into robust career development opportunities within a dynamic, innovative environment at Nokia.
Qualifications

Must-Have:

  • BSc Electrical Engineering Degree or relevant education, training, and experience
  • Proven experience in PCB layout, preferably in high-speed and high-density applications
  • Experience with Cadence CIS and Cadence Allegro
  • Familiarity with PCB fabrication processes, DFM best practices, and IPC standards
  • Strong understanding of signal integrity, power integrity, and thermal management principles

Nice-To-Have:

  • Experience with HDI and MSAP
  • Understanding of analog and digital electronics
  • Excellent collaboration and communication skills
  • Ability to mentor less experienced designers

What you need to know about the Chennai Tech Scene

To locals, it's no secret that South India is leading the charge in big data infrastructure. While the environmental impact of data centers has long been a concern, emerging hubs like Chennai are favored by companies seeking ready access to renewable energy resources, which provide more sustainable and cost-effective solutions. As a result, Chennai, along with neighboring Bengaluru and Hyderabad, is poised for significant growth, with a projected 65 percent increase in data center capacity over the next decade.
